SALDANA AND MOTTER TEAM LAUNCH BID FOR ANOTHER VICTORY

SPENCER, Iowa (Sept. 11, 2013) – Joey Saldana and the Motter Motorsports team made significant gains during the World of Outlaws West Coast swing.  They scored their first victory in Chico, Calif., and within the last three races jumped from sixth to fourth in Outlaws point standings.

With racing returning to the Midwest Friday, Sept. 13 at Clay County Fair Speedway in Spencer, Iowa and Sept. 14 at Deer Creek Speedway in Spring Valley, Minn., Saldana

hopes he and the team are able to maintain the consistency and strong performance they have developed since switching to the GF1 chassis and Pro shocks at the Ironman the weekend before the Knoxville Nationals. 

The switch paid immediate dividends with the Motter Equipment Beltline Body Shop Fatheadz Eyewear 71M Sprint car earning the pole at the Knoxville Nationals, out-performing over 100 entries for the prestigious position. 

The team’s victory in Chico was noteworthy as the Brownsburg Bullet bested over 50 other drivers to become ‘Top Gun’ during Friday’s Gold Cup Race of Champions.

“We had been close to winning and could just never close the deal,” said Saldana.  “We finally got the monkey off our back and we’re running strong.  We are looking for a solid finish to the season.”

With less than a dozen races left before the season concludes, the Outlaws event this weekend at the Clay County Fair Speedway promises to draw a great crowd as fair-goers traditionally pack the house for the “Greatest Show on Dirt.”

On Saturday, Saldana will race in team owner Dan Motter’s home state of Minnesota.

Saldana won the inaugural Outlaws race at Deer Creek Spedway in 2009 and successfully defended his title in 2010. He has won 50 percent of the races on this 3/8-mile high-bank, and is the only repeat winner. 

“We have high hopes for another win at this track,” said Motter.  “We weren’t able to be in Chico for that win, but it would be nice to celebrate a victory with the team, our friends and family at Deer Creek.”

“We know we have a fast car and a great team,” said Saldana. “And we know we have a good a shot at victory every time we buckle up.  Mentally we know we can do it.  We are motivated to get back in winner’s circle for an extended stay!”
